What does Adalina mean?

Odd girl name Adalina is chiefly used in English, Finnish, Swedish and Danish has its origin in Germanic, Adalina means "Of Noble Figure". Adalina is variant of long standing and well-known Adela.

Adela is diminutive of names with "nobility". Adela is equivalent of Adele in Italian language. Also Adela is equivalent of Names Containing the Name Element Adal in German language. Anomalous Germanic and Old High German Adela, meaning of Adela is "Lust and Noble".

Adalina is variant form of eternal and illustrous Adelina. Adelina is variant form of celebrated, biblical and immutable Ada. Also Adelina is variant form of immutable and celebrated Adela. Adelina is also a form of mainstream leading, everlasting and loved Adeline.

Adelina is also form of timeless and commonly accepted Alida. Also Adelina is spelling variation of ADAL;LIN. Adelina means Noble is of Germanic, Latin and German origin. Adalina is shortened form of Adelheid.

Adelheid is form of eternal and trendy Adela. Also Adelheid is form of immutable and customary Adelaide. Adelheid is German cognate of Adalhaid. Originated from Germanic and Old High German, Offbeat Adelheid, Adelheid means "Of a Noble Kind and Of Noble Figure".

How popular is the name Adalina?

A common name in United States with over 1291 new-borns have been given the name since 1922. Currently the name is rising, in 2018, it ranked 1451st when 153 parents chose the moniker for their baby girls.

Adalina is a rare baby name in England and Wales where it is still in use. Also, Adalina is a familiar name in Uzbekistan, Mexico, Brazil, Dominican Republic, Paraguay, Colombia, Russia, Honduras and Venezuela.
